Interference aware routing in multi-radio multi-channel wireless mesh networks

Abstract

An interference aware routing algorithm for multi-radio WMNs (Wireless Mesh Networks) is presented in this paper. It can choose high-throughput and low-interference paths by using a new path metric ERC (Expected Residual Capacity). Combined with the idea of multi-path routing, the algorithm can distribute traffic among several optimized paths to maximize the utilization of multiple radios. Simulation results show that the interference aware routing can reduce communication interference and balance network traffic effectively. The aggregate network throughput of our routing surpasses the standard 802.11 networks greatly and outperforms existing multi-channel routing too.
